Structural characterization, morphological and the magnetic composite of PVDF / Pani / Nickel

Description

The incorporation of conductive fillers and the discovery of intrinsic conductive polymers in the preparation of conductive blends and composites have great emphasis in research. In our study, morphologic, structural and magnetic properties of composite PVDF / Pani with the incorporation of nickel particles by physically mixing the resulting powder with the synthesis of polymeric material were studied. Flexible and homogeneous films were obtained by pressing at 180 ° C. Diffraction analysis (XRD), magnetic survey (M-H) rays were done, and scanning (SEM) electron microscopy. The results showed characteristic X-ray peaks of α phase of PVDF and the nickel particles, the micrographs confirmed the presence of the nickel particles homogeneously dispersed throughout the film. The magnetic survey showed that the composite passes a diamagnetic behavior for the presence of ferromagnetic particles.(author)
